Transaction ad91ef13a11004ccc80927ec83e69b6f50f7dc6c40cb7adce379f9dfbf620734
1 Input
1 Output
-
ad91ef13a11004ccc80927ec83e69b6f50f7dc6c40cb7adce379f9dfbf620734:0
- value
- 42142
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d2cbf3f1c61f20eb86ba7609554bf33e6948712 OP_EQUAL
- address
- 3MrUs21mHru7A54z28hNirbT5KvEiRzcTg